cops did use mustangs a few years back. I do not think they used hatchbacks though, I think it was LX's. The whole "Police Intercepter" is nothing more better alternator, silicone hoses, trans oil cooler, and other little things like that. Nothing special about the actually motor or computer. If I remember the police cars had the A9L motor which responded better. But mine was not a police car and had the A9L computer.
